Comprehensive Service Overview

HVAC services in Cumberland Furnace typically cover a range of needs shaped by our local weather and housing stock. During those sweltering Tennessee summers, attention turns to air conditioning repairs and tune-ups that address root causes like refrigerant leaks or compressor strain, helping restore even cooling and better humidity control. In winter, focus shifts to heating systemsโ€”often heat pumps or gas furnacesโ€”where diagnostics pinpoint issues like ignition failures or blower problems.

Homeowners commonly schedule preventative maintenance to catch wear early, improving energy use and comfort while reducing strain on aging units found in many older homes. Upgrades to high-efficiency models make sense here, given fluctuating utility rates and the push for better indoor air quality amid pollen-heavy springs. Thorough troubleshooting goes beyond quick fixes, ensuring systems run smoothly through seasonal shifts.

Expect considerations for ductwork in ranch homes or modular setups in rural builds, with an eye toward code-compliant work that protects properties. Same-day or next-day responses are often available for pressing concerns, keeping families comfortable without long waits.

Regional Characteristics

Cumberland Furnace features a blend of older farmhouses, ranch-style homes, and some newer developments in this low-density, rural-suburban setting. The rolling terrain and proximity to wooded areas influence installation challenges, while Tennessee's hot, humid summers (often over 90ยฐF) and occasional winter freezes demand robust HVAC systems like heat pumps and central air units. Many properties have ducted systems adapted to moderate-sized homes, with higher emphasis on dehumidification and energy efficiency due to utility costs and variable weather.

Common Issues

Residents frequently deal with AC not cooling adequately during peak summer humidity, furnace failures in unexpected cold snaps, poor airflow from clogged filters or duct problems, uneven temperatures across rooms, and thermostat glitches. High pollen and dust from surrounding fields can affect indoor air quality, leading to more frequent maintenance needs. Strange odors or noises often signal refrigerant issues or component wear common in our climate.
